WebSep 22, 2024 · GC held that the use of benefits under 38 U.S.C. chapter 31 does not limit the use of education benefits listed in 38 U.S.C. § 3695 (a). However, use of educational benefits listed in section 3695 (a) could limit the number of months of assistance to which a service-disabled veteran may be entitled under chapter 31.
